Nice! Enjoyed the prologue very much.

The "impossible" Storm is obviously created by the DO. So, does the DO actually want that the humans go north, so that the Trolloc army can kill them? Or are the people drawn north due to ta'veren/Wheel-effect?

The Seanchan will yet become more convinced that the Shadow is the enemy (Tylee already thought about an alliance), after the Trolloc attack and the news that Anath was a Forsaken. This will finally lead to the alliance, IMO even before the Seanchan attack the WT. If Semirhage tells Rand that Mesaana is in the WT and that many AS are working for the Shadow (as Mesaana states it at the meeting), I believe Rand will press for a liberation of the WT.

It seems Mesaana is indeed an AS, though I still don't really see why Alviarin thinks then that her true voice and face are familiar.

The idea that Moridin voluntarily created the link between him and Rand becomes even more far-fetched, after we saw yet again that Moridin suffers, when Rand suffers. This is obviously the reason why Moridin wasn't at the Cleansing or doesn't want Rand harmed. Moridin fears that this could backfire at him. Therefore Moridin also didn't send the Trolloc army in KoD. In the end, Rand will certainly use this link to kill Moridin.

I was surprised, though, that Semirhage lost all of the DO's favour and that she actually was too incompetent to capture Rand in KoD. Now the only Forsaken who have still a high standing are Moridin, Graendal and Demandred.

I believe Graendal will soon send assassins to kill people in Rand's party like Bashere, and also Ituralde to create chaos (he is the dying man in a bed from Egwene's Dream).

By the way, it's interesting that we have yet another Graendal PoV ajnd once again she doesn't think about killing Asmo (though she thinks about other Forsaken and her standing). That is addressed at those Graendaldunnits who believe that Slayer MUST of course have thought of Asmo in his single, short PoV , if he was the killer..

As often said in the past, I believe Demandred controlled Masema. This explains Sammael's comment about Demandred's "friends" in the south. Besides that, he likely controls the King of Murandy who gaters an army at the moment. Demandred's statement that he wants to kill Rand, supports the idea that Demandred didn't send Slayer as the patron in WH )IMO it was osan'gar) and that Aran'gar posed as Demandred to send the DF Asha'man to kill Rand. It's also clear that Demandred didn't send that Trolloc army in KoD. It was either done by Graendal or Semirhage.
